about the festival
The City of Venice, FL in Sarasota County has been named the "Shark's Tooth Capital of the World" because of the millions of shark teeth that wash up on their sandy white beaches.
The Sharks Tooth Festival takes place each Spring against the back drop of Venice’s best shark tooth hunting beach, where fossil collectors from around the Southeast display and sell sharks teeth and other prehistoric fossils. More than 100 artists from around the State market their original work. Food vendors serve up delicious dishes from seafood to BBQ. Live entertainment is on stage throughout the Festival. Children are entertained with such events as the Sharks Tooth Scramble and Mote Marine’s hands on exhibit.
